The folder ""Application data\coffeecup software\TempDir" would be something on your local computer, not on the remote server.

Try this, go to the File Menu > Export > Export Shops for Upload and save your shop. Now use a 3rd party FTP program and upload everything. Let me know if that works.

Also under the Shop Settings > Remote Folder what have you entered in there? In your FTP program, what folder do you upload to (httpdocs, public_html etc..)
